Idle Oak jcr sessions in AEM 6.1

Hello Oak devs,

AEM 6.1 GA logs a bunch of WARN messages of idle sessions that might be out of date, see bottom of mail .

We are in the process of logging Jira issues to prevent their apparition from the various product components involved.

However, customers can worry about this , and we would like to inform them what it means technically and why they should not worry about them .

Could someone provide us with a meaningful explanation ? @Harsh, this information could end up in an Oak KB Article .

Thanks a lot.

16.06.2015 11:32:42.779 *WARN* [0:0:0:0:0:0:0:1 [1434468762730] GET /etc/replication/agents.author.pages.json HTTP/1.1] org.apache.jackrabbit.oak.jcr.session.RefreshStrategy This session has been idle for 3 minutes and might be out of date. Consider using a fresh session or explicitly refresh the session.
